Hello,

I just bought a new 2016 2500 4x4 with the 6.4. I have about 750 miles on it, and ever since new i have been hearing this really annoying whistle/air noise coming from the engine bay (i think). The best way i can describe the noise is a low pitched whistle, almost similar to turbo spool, or sometimes the sound you get from an aftermarket intake. In my opinion it is loud. loud enough to hear it over the radio on volume 10, and definitely noticeable. Here is some information:

1) it seems to happen at ANY speed above 50 mph, but it is not wind noise. I know this because at any speed above 50 I can hear it but if i just barely lift the throttle (while going down a hill or something) the noise stops. Also, if I click up to 5th gear manually, the noise stops immediately and cannot be heard until i put it back in 6th and the RPM are around 1500.

2) I occasionally hear a variance of the noise (much quieter) when accelerating through the gears lightly, but not ever time and its harder to reproduce vs. going 65mph when i can make it do it on command every single time.

3) The noise seems to be accompanied by a loud tick, or audible switch noise. For example, when i hear it upon acceleration, I hear the noise, then hear a click when the truck shifts, and the noise instantly stops after the click, and then resumes again. But this seems more random than the highway speeds, but im sure its the same noise.

4) happens cold/hot. It does it right away first thing in the morning before the truck has warmed up. And it does it after driving 50+ miles, and all day long.

5) Ive tried every combination of fuel (87, 89, 91) no change.

6) Ive tired vent/AC/Heather on, off, low, high, and every combination in between. No change.


I really am starting to get annoyed and its the only thing I can hear now when I drive to work. I took it to the dealer and of course they said they couldn't find anything. I even took the guy for a drive and made sure he heard it. He said its probably nothing to worry about and bring it in if it gets louder or something else happens.... but I cant believe this noise is normal.


Any advice would be very much appreciated! Thank you!

Update on my 5.7 - when I picked it up after the harmonic balancer repair, I hadn't got a mile down the road before hearing the same noise, same volume.

Took it back and had a tech ride with me until he knew exactly what I was wanting addressed. He agreed that the noise sounded more like a vacuum leak or similar, as it changed volume with engine load as opposed to engine RPM. They called me that afternoon and said there was an exhaust leak and they had to order parts, which are backordered. As soon as they are in and the work is done, I'll report back again.

Just bought 2500 with the 6.4 only 800 miles on it. I have the same noise. Had it at the dealer for 3 days. They emailed corporate and talked with there head engineers. They are saying it is some sort of exhaust noise and they are aware of the issue but there is nothing they are going to do for it. Drove a new one from the lot same noise. So there is an issue Chrysler/ram doesn't want to fix it or address it. $5100 for a truck kinda of bs.
